Join a university ranked 1st in the UK for chemistry research and in the UK top five for physics research (THE analysis of REF 2021) with an excellent reputation for teaching and learning.This four-year MSci course is for those considering scientific careers that will make direct use of their subject-specific knowledge and skills. The first and second years of this course are identical to MSci Chemical Physics but your third year will be spent on a placement as a paid employee in a company.You will focus on areas at the interface between chemistry and physics, emphasising cross-disciplinary topics such as materials science and nanoscience,As well as lectures and practical classes, small-group tutorials and workshops help develop your understanding of challenging and exciting concepts. Practical labs in both chemistry and physics help develop experimental techniques, computational modelling, and programming skills needed in the final year for conducting a research project with a research team.Our graduates have an excellent record of employment across a range of industries.
